Yes, you can build muscle while on statins. However, it’s crucial to monitor how your body responds to exercise since statins can cause muscle pain or weakness in some individuals. Stick to a balanced diet rich in protein and engage in regular strength training. Always work with your healthcare provider to ensure your exercise regimen is safe and effective while on statins, and report any unusual symptoms immediately.**

- Can statins cause muscle pain during exercise? Yes, statins may cause muscle pain or weakness in some individuals, making it important to monitor your body’s response to strength training.
- Is it safe to do strength training while taking statins? Strength training is generally safe while on statins if you follow a balanced diet, start gradually, and consult your healthcare provider regularly.
- What dietary changes help build muscle on statins? A balanced diet rich in protein supports muscle growth and can help mitigate side effects while using statin medications.
- When should I seek medical advice if exercising on statins? If you experience unusual muscle pain, weakness, or other symptoms during exercise while on statins, contact your healthcare provider immediately.
